An optimized transgenesis system for Drosophila using germ-line-specific phiC31 integrases. board ghostsWebThe φC31 integrase system represents a novel technology that opens up new possibilities for gene therapy. The φC31 integrase can integrate introduced plasmid DNA into preferred locations in unmodified mammalian genomes, resulting in robust, long-term expression of the integrated transgene.
